Ibrahimovic played a starring role for Milan as they came from 2-0 down to record a surprise 4-2 victory over the league leaders, with the former Sweden international scoring once and assisting another strike en route to his side's come-from-behind triumph.
The 38-year-old, who returned to the Rossoneri in January, was in high spirits after the match and boldly claimed that the club would have won the Serie A title this season if he had joined at the start of the campaign.
"I am president, coach and player, but they only pay me as a footballer."
Ibrahimovic has scored five goals in 11 Serie A appearances for Milan this season, and is now just three strikes away from recording 50 league goals for the club, having netted 42 times in 61 appearances during his first spell with the Rossoneri.
